Finite element analysis of large diameter high strength octagonal CFST short columns
MF Hassanein, VI Patel, M Elchalakani, HT Thai
Thin Walled Structures | ELSEVIER SCI LTD | Published : 2018
Abstract
Octagonal masonry columns have been broadly used in outstanding architectural heritage due to their aesthetical appearance and to support high loads. Nowadays, concrete-filled steel tubular (CFST) columns have been utilised to carry such high load. However, a recent trend in the construction of the CFST columns is to use the high strength concrete (HSC) to increase the usable floor spaces in different buildings due to the global limited land areas. Therefore, this paper combines the architectural demand of the octagonal column shape with the advantages of the CFST columns by investigating numerically, by means of finite element (FE) modelling, the octagonal CFST short columns.
